Japanese artist Haruka Matsuo dived into the soil of the IJssel and found the most beautiful clay. The starting point for IJssel Orbit, her project along the IJssel.
Haruka and Jacolijn know each other from the Gerrit Rietveld Academy. Haruka grew up in Japan, Jacolijn in the Netherlands and both have their own tea culture. The Dutch and Japanese tea cultures are very different, but some things seem universal.
